The Efficiency Of Plate Type Heat Exchangers For Various Industrial Applications

plate type heat exchangers are vital components in various industrial processes, offering efficient heat transfer capabilities in compact and cost-effective designs. These heat exchangers consist of a series of plates with intricate patterns, providing a large surface area for heat exchange between two fluids. The versatility and effectiveness of plate type heat exchangers make them indispensable in applications ranging from HVAC systems to food processing industries.

One of the key advantages of plate type heat exchangers is their high thermal efficiency. The design of the plates allows for turbulent flow of the fluids, maximizing the heat transfer coefficient and reducing thermal resistance. This results in efficient heat transfer between the hot and cold fluids, leading to significant energy savings in the process. The compact size of plate type heat exchangers further enhances their efficiency by reducing the overall footprint and material costs.

Another benefit of plate type heat exchangers is their flexibility in accommodating various flow rates and temperature differentials. The modular design of the plates allows for easy customization of the heat exchanger to meet specific process requirements. This adaptability makes plate type heat exchangers suitable for a wide range of applications, from cooling water in power plants to heating fluids in chemical processes. Moreover, the ability to add or remove plates offers scalability and easy maintenance for optimal performance.

plate type heat exchangers are also known for their durability and reliability in harsh operating conditions. The materials used in the construction of the plates, such as stainless steel or titanium, are corrosion-resistant and can withstand high temperatures and pressures. This makes plate type heat exchangers ideal for applications that involve aggressive fluids or extreme operating conditions. The robust design of these heat exchangers ensures long service life and minimal maintenance requirements, reducing downtime and overall operating costs.

In addition to their thermal efficiency and durability, plate type heat exchangers offer quick and efficient heat transfer across a wide range of temperature differentials. The turbulent flow induced by the plate patterns promotes effective mixing of the fluids, enhancing heat transfer rates. This rapid heat exchange capability is crucial in processes that require precise temperature control or fast response times, such as in the food and beverage industry. plate type heat exchangers can easily achieve close temperature approaches between the hot and cold fluids, ensuring optimal thermal performance.

Plate type heat exchangers find applications in various industries, where efficient heat transfer is essential for production processes. In HVAC systems, plate type heat exchangers are used for heat recovery and energy conservation in air conditioning units and ventilation systems. The compact design of these heat exchangers allows for easy integration into existing cooling and heating systems, improving overall efficiency and reducing operating costs. In the food processing industry, plate type heat exchangers are employed for pasteurization, sterilization, and cooling of beverages and dairy products. The hygienic design of these heat exchangers ensures safe and sanitary food processing, meeting stringent quality standards.

Furthermore, plate type heat exchangers play a vital role in the chemical and pharmaceutical industries, where precise temperature control and efficient heat transfer are crucial for various processes. These heat exchangers are used for heating, cooling, condensation, and evaporation of chemicals and pharmaceutical products. The versatility and reliability of plate type heat exchangers make them indispensable in ensuring product quality, process efficiency, and regulatory compliance in these industries.
